What Exactly Are Adverse Drug Reactions?
Let’s clear up the terminology first. You’ve probably heard the terms "side effect" and "adverse drug reaction" (ADR) used interchangeably, but there’s a technical distinction. A side effect is any unintended effect of a drug at normal doses. An adverse drug reaction is specifically a harmful or noxious response. Think of it this way: if a chemotherapy drug causes hair loss, that’s a side effect. If that same drug causes severe internal bleeding, that’s an adverse reaction.
The modern understanding of drug safety was born from tragedy. In the early 1960s, the drug thalidomide was prescribed to pregnant women for morning sickness. It resulted in approximately 10,000 infants worldwide being born with severe limb deformities. This disaster led to the Kefauver-Harris Amendment of 1962, which forced manufacturers to prove both safety and efficacy before selling drugs. Today, organizations like the World Health Organization define an ADR as a response to a medicine that is noxious and unintended, occurring at doses normally used for therapy.
Doctors and pharmacists classify these reactions into two main types:
- Type A Reactions: These are predictable and dose-dependent. They make sense based on what the drug does chemically. For example, if a blood thinner makes you bleed more easily, that’s a Type A reaction. These account for 75-80% of all adverse events.
- Type B Reactions: These are unpredictable and often immune-mediated. They don’t relate to the drug’s primary action. A classic example is an allergic rash to penicillin. These account for 15-20% of cases but are often more severe.
The Most Common Side Effects You Might Experience
If you’re worried about rare, scary conditions, take a breath. Most side effects are mild and manageable. According to data from MedStar Health and Harvard Health, the most frequent complaints fall into three categories: gastrointestinal, neurological, and dermatological.
Gastrointestinal issues are incredibly common because pills have to pass through your digestive system. Nausea, upset stomach, constipation, diarrhea, and dry mouth are the usual suspects. Nearly any drug can cause nausea, though it only happens to a small percentage of people. If you’re taking heartburn medications like omeprazole (Prilosec), you might experience constipation or headache. Blood pressure meds like metoprolol (Lopressor) often lead to drowsiness or lightheadedness.
Neurological symptoms include headaches, dizziness, and fatigue. Anti-anxiety medications such as alprazolam (Xanax) or lorazepam (Ativan) frequently cause confusion and drowsiness. This is particularly risky for older adults. MedStar Health warns that using high doses of these drugs can significantly increase the risk of falling and delirium in people aged 65 and older.
Skin reactions, like mild rashes, are also common. The FDA defines "common" side effects as those occurring in more than 1% of patients. If you experience these, don’t panic immediately. Often, your body adjusts after a few days. However, if they persist or interfere with your daily life, talk to your doctor. They might adjust the dose or switch you to a different medication.
When to Worry: Signs of Severe Reactions
Not all side effects are created equal. Some require immediate emergency care. The FDA classifies a side effect as "serious" if it results in death, life-threatening conditions, hospitalization, disability, or birth defects. Here are the red flags you need to watch for:
- Anaphylaxis: This is a sudden, severe allergic reaction. Symptoms include swelling of the lips, tongue, or throat, trouble breathing, and widespread hives. Call emergency services immediately.
- Stevens-Johnson Syndrome (SJS): A rare but dangerous skin condition causing severe rash, skin peeling, and fever. Toxic Epidermal Necrolysis (TEN) is an even more extreme form that can lead to kidney and lung injury.
- DRESS Syndrome: Drug Reaction with Eosinophilia and Systemic Symptoms. Look for abnormal blood counts, rash, enlarged lymph nodes, and liver injury. It can affect multiple organs including the heart and lungs.
Other serious signs include suicidal thoughts, abnormal heart rhythms, and internal bleeding. Remember the case of efalizumab (Raptiva), a psoriasis drug taken off the market in 2009. It carried a black box warning due to reports of brain infections and meningitis. While rare, these examples show why vigilance matters. If you feel something is seriously wrong, trust your gut and seek help.
Special Risks for Older Adults and Cancer Patients
Your age and underlying health conditions play a huge role in how you react to medication. The elderly are particularly vulnerable. A 2021 National Ambulatory Medical Care Survey found that patients aged 65 and older experience adverse drug events at a rate of 17.3 per 1,000 population, compared to just 5.5 per 1,000 for adults aged 45-64.
Why the difference? Older adults often take multiple medications (polypharmacy), have slower metabolism, and may have reduced kidney or liver function. Even common over-the-counter drugs pose risks. NSAIDs like naproxen (Aleve) can cause bleeding and swelling. Diphenhydramine (Benadryl), a common allergy med, blocks acetylcholine, leading to drowsiness and dry mouth, which can worsen confusion in seniors.
Cancer treatments bring their own unique challenges. Chemotherapy targets rapidly dividing cells, which includes cancer cells but also healthy cells like those in hair follicles and the gut. Common side effects include fatigue, bruising, infection risk, hair loss, anemia, and severe nausea. Radiotherapy side effects depend on the treatment area. Abdominal radiation often causes diarrhea, while head and neck radiation leads to dry mouth and difficulty swallowing. These effects are usually temporary but require careful management by your oncology team.
How Drug Interactions Change the Game
A drug doesn’t exist in a vacuum. It interacts with everything else in your body, including other medicines, food, and alcohol. WebMD points out that side effects may only appear when a drug is mixed with certain other things. For instance, drinking alcohol while taking narcotic painkillers can cause accidental overdose and has led to many deaths.
Food interactions are surprisingly common. Grapefruit juice contains compounds that block enzymes responsible for breaking down certain drugs. This can cause blood levels of medications like some blood pressure and cholesterol drugs to spike to dangerous levels. Always ask your pharmacist if your meds interact with specific foods.
The stakes of ignoring interactions are high. A 2022 study in the Journal of Managed Care & Specialty Pharmacy found that approximately 50% of patients discontinue their medications within the first year due to side effects. Gastrointestinal issues accounted for 28% of these discontinuations. If you stop taking essential medication because of unmanaged side effects, you risk worsening your underlying condition. Proper management involves timing doses correctly, taking meds with food if recommended, and staying hydrated.
Reporting Side Effects: Why Your Voice Matters
Here’s the hard truth: less than 5% of all adverse drug reactions are formally reported to regulatory authorities. This underreporting means doctors and regulators miss crucial data that could prevent future harm. Reporting isn’t just bureaucracy; it’s public service.
In the United States, the FDA’s MedWatch program is the primary channel for reporting. Healthcare professionals are legally required to report certain serious reactions, but patients can do it too. The FDA reviewed 1.8 million adverse event reports in one recent year alone. The highest reporting rates were for immunomodulatory drugs and anticoagulants.
In the UK, the Yellow Card Scheme allows anyone-patients, carers, and healthcare professionals-to report suspected side effects. The European Medicines Agency operates EudraVigilance for EU-wide monitoring. These systems help identify patterns that weren’t visible during clinical trials, which often involve limited demographics and shorter timeframes.
You don’t need to be a medical expert to report. Just document what happened: the drug name, dosage, when you took it, and the symptoms you experienced. Include any other medications you were taking. This data helps agencies issue safety alerts, update labels, or even withdraw dangerous drugs from the market.

Practical Steps for Medication Safety
So, how do you protect yourself? Start by keeping a complete list of all medications, supplements, and vitamins you take. Share this list with every doctor and pharmacist you see. Don’t assume they know what you’re already taking.
Read the patient information leaflet included with your prescription. It lists common side effects and warnings. Use resources like the NHS medicines A-Z page or the National Library of Medicine’s database to learn more about your specific drugs. If a side effect is bothersome, persistent, or severe, consult your healthcare provider. Don’t suffer in silence.
Consider scheduling regular medication reviews, especially if you’re over 65 or take multiple drugs. Ask your doctor: "Do I still need this medication?" and "Are there safer alternatives?" Sometimes, deprescribing-stopping unnecessary medications-is the best way to reduce side effects.
Finally, stay vigilant. Your body knows when something is off. If you notice new symptoms after starting a drug, write them down. Track when they happen and how long they last. This information is invaluable for your doctor and for the broader medical community.
How long does it take for side effects to appear?
Side effects can appear immediately, within hours, or even weeks after starting a medication. Mild gastrointestinal issues often start within the first few days. Allergic reactions typically occur quickly, sometimes within minutes. Some serious reactions, like liver damage, may develop slowly over time. If you notice any new symptoms after starting a drug, monitor them closely and report them if they persist.
Can I stop my medication if I experience side effects?
Don’t stop taking prescribed medication abruptly without consulting your doctor. Suddenly stopping some drugs, like beta-blockers or antidepressants, can cause withdrawal symptoms or rebound effects. Instead, contact your healthcare provider. They may adjust the dose, switch to a different drug, or suggest ways to manage the side effects. Only stop emergency medications if directed by a professional.
Is grapefruit juice really dangerous with medication?
Yes, grapefruit juice can be dangerous with certain medications. It contains furanocoumarins that inhibit the enzyme CYP3A4 in your gut, which breaks down many drugs. This can cause drug levels in your blood to rise to toxic levels. Common affected drugs include statins (cholesterol meds), some blood pressure medications, and immunosuppressants. Always check with your pharmacist if you enjoy grapefruit.
Who should report side effects to the FDA or Yellow Card Scheme?
Anyone can report side effects. While healthcare professionals are often required to report serious events, patients and caregivers play a crucial role. Underreporting is a major issue, so your personal experience adds valuable data. You can report via the FDA’s MedWatch website in the US or the MHRA’s Yellow Card Scheme in the UK. Provide details about the drug, dosage, and symptoms to help investigators identify patterns.
Why do older adults have more side effects?
Older adults face higher risks due to physiological changes. Kidney and liver function decline with age, slowing drug metabolism and excretion. This leads to higher drug concentrations in the body. Additionally, older adults often take multiple medications (polypharmacy), increasing the chance of interactions. Changes in body composition, like increased fat and decreased water, also alter how drugs are distributed. Regular medication reviews are essential for this group.
